Communications Assistant job description

A Communications Assistant supports the development and execution of communication strategies, ensuring consistent and effective messaging across various platforms. This role is vital for maintaining brand reputation, engaging stakeholders, and facilitating clear internal and external communications.

Briefcase
Hiring for this role?
POST THIS JOB FOR FREE
Arrow
Folder Search
Find more suitable candidates for this role ?
TRY FOR FREE
Arrow

What is a Communications Assistant?

A Communications Assistant is an entry-level or support role within a company's communications or public relations department. This professional assists in creating and distributing content, managing media relations, and supporting overall communication efforts to promote the organization's image and objectives. They work under the supervision of communications managers or directors, helping to implement strategies that enhance visibility and engagement with key audiences.

What does a Communications Assistant do?

A Communications Assistant performs a variety of tasks to support the communications team. They draft and edit press releases, social media posts, newsletters, and other content. They also assist with media outreach, monitor news coverage, and maintain databases of contacts. Additionally, they help organize events, track communication metrics, and provide administrative support to ensure smooth operation of the department. Their work contributes to building and maintaining positive relationships with the public, media, and internal stakeholders.

Job Overview

A Communications Assistant provides essential support to the communications team in developing and executing effective communication strategies. This entry-level role involves assisting with content creation, media relations, social media management, and internal communications to enhance organizational visibility and maintain brand consistency across all platforms.

Communications Assistant responsibilities include:

1. Draft and edit press releases, newsletters, blog posts, and social media content 2. Monitor media coverage and compile daily media reports using Meltwater or Cision 3. Assist in maintaining company website content through WordPress or similar CMS 4. Support event coordination and logistics for press conferences and corporate events 5. Manage social media calendars and engage with audience across platforms (LinkedIn, Twitter, Instagram) 6. Conduct media list building and maintain PR contact databases 7. Assist with creating presentation materials and communication collateral 8. Track communication metrics and prepare performance reports using Google Analytics 9. Coordinate with internal teams to gather information for communication materials 10. Provide administrative support for communications department operations
Want to generate an attractive job description?

Must-Have Requirements

1. Bachelor's degree in Communications, Public Relations, Journalism, or related field 2. 1-2 years of experience in communications, marketing, or related role (internships included) 3. Excellent written and verbal communication skills with strong attention to detail 4. Proficiency in Microsoft Office Suite (Word, Excel, PowerPoint, Outlook) 5. Basic understanding of social media platforms and digital communication tools 6. Ability to multitask and meet deadlines in fast-paced environment 7. Strong proofreading and editing skills with AP Style knowledge 8. Professional demeanor and ability to maintain confidentiality 9. Portfolio demonstrating writing samples and communication projects

Preferred Qualifications

1. Experience with media monitoring tools (Meltwater, Cision, or Critical Mention) 2. Knowledge of WordPress, Mailchimp, or similar content management systems 3. Familiarity with basic graphic design tools (Canva, Adobe Creative Suite) 4. Previous agency experience or corporate communications background 5. Understanding of SEO principles and digital marketing strategies 6. Experience with video editing or basic multimedia content creation 7. Crisis communications experience or media relations exposure 8. Bilingual capabilities (Spanish preferred in US market) 9. Experience with project management tools (Asana, Trello, or Basecamp)

Bonus Skills

1. Google Analytics certification or digital analytics experience 2. HTML/CSS basic coding skills for website updates 3. Experience with media database management (Vocus, PR Newswire) 4. Photography or videography skills for content creation 5. Event planning and coordination experience 6. Knowledge of email marketing platforms (Constant Contact, HubSpot) 7. Experience with social media scheduling tools (Hootsuite, Buffer) 8. Background in crisis communications or issues management 9. Familiarity with PR measurement tools and ROI reporting

Are you ready to innovate your recruitment process?

Join thousands of leading companies and experience the next generation of intelligent recruitment

No credit card required | 7-day full-featured trial | Dedicated customer support

Frequently Asked Questions

Your questions, answered

Everything you need to know about TalentSeek and how itcan transform your hiring process.

What is TalentSeek

toggle

TalentSeek is an AI-powered global recruitment platform designed to make hiring talent worldwide faster, smarter, and more affordable. Powered by advanced AI Agents, TalentSeek helps companies effortlessly connect with top professionals across borders — breaking human network limits and reducing hiring costs. Start hiring globally with ease. One platform, endless talent.

Who can use TalentSeek ?

toggle

TalentSeek is built for recruiters. If you are searching for Global Talent or hard-to-find talent, TalentSeek is a fit for you. We work with companies ranging from Fortune 500 to boutique recruiting agencies — and hopefully, you too.

What distinguishes TalentSeek from other recruitment tools?

toggle

TalentSeek is an AI-driven global recruitment platform that enables real-time searching of over 900 million job seekers across more than 200 countries and regions. This platform empowers companies to effortlessly connect with top professionals beyond borders, breaking the limitations of personal networks and reducing hiring costs.

Does TalentSeek have access to global candidate data?

toggle

Yes. TalentSeek has 900 million profiles across the globe from dozens of data sources. Covers over 200 countries and regions worldwide.We continue to add region-specific sources to enhance global coverage.

Is there a free trial available for TalentSeek?

toggle

Yes. To get started, use the "Start for Free" button to open the platform. Then, sign up or log in to access your account.